-
Notifications
You must be signed in to change notification settings - Fork 0
/
action.yml
32 lines (32 loc) · 1.21 KB
/
action.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
# action.yml
name: 'Cautious Broccoli'
description: 'Cautious Broccoli runs bug-free-tribble'
branding:
icon: 'send'
color: 'blue'
inputs:
repository:
description: 'Repository name with owner.'
default: ${{ github.repository }}
required: false
prnumber:
description: 'Pull request number.'
default: ${{ github.event.pull_request.number }}
required: false
token:
description: >
Personal access token (PAT) used to fetch information from the repository.
The PAT is configured with the local git config, which enables your scripts
to run authenticated git commands. The post-job step removes the PAT.
We recommend using a service account with the least permissions necessary.
Also when generating a new PAT, select the least scopes necessary.
[Learn more about creating and using encrypted secrets](https://help.github.com/en/actions/automating-your-workflow-with-github-actions/creating-and-using-encrypted-secrets)
default: ${{ github.token }}
required: false
dockerimage:
description: 'Docker image'
default: 'docker://exploredev/bug-free-tribble:v0.4'
required: false
runs:
using: 'docker'
image: ${{ github.event.inputs.dockerimage }}